Re: do your boobs come out bigger/smaller than when...
They def end up smaller than when you try the implants in a bra. This is because when the implant is in the bra on top of your boob, there is lots of empty space inside the bra as it won't 'fit' properly! So they will project out further and look bigger when you try them. When the implant is inside you it's a perfect fit, so to speak. xx
